Key ceremony checklist, item 7 — Marrowgate Library catalogue import. Before the import service can decrypt the quarterly catalogue feed from the Ostley branch network, support must confirm both custodians are present and the ceremony log is countersigned. Verify the import queue is paused and the staging catalogue matches the manifest row count. Do not proceed if either custodian is remote. Once both signatures are recorded, unlock the import keyring by entering the recovery passphrase that appears below this item.

recovery phrase for kajep-tajep: ulaox-ralax-gorwyn

## Configuration: Cache Invalidation

Heads up, on-call folks: the Shelfwise catalog cache invalidates via a fan-out topic, not TTLs. If product prices look stale, it's almost always the invalidator worker, not the cache itself. Bump `CATALOG_INVALIDATE_BATCH` down to 50 if the queue backs up overnight — it recovers faster that way. The worker authenticates to the invalidation bus on startup, so make sure your env file includes this line:

env line for yahip-tafog: RELAY_SECRET3=4ca

Handover Note – Directors, Stavemill Exports

For the board, as I hand the reins to Ilona: the big open item is the currency-hedging call. We've been running unhedged on the taler exposure all year and mostly got lucky. Treasury's recommendation is to lock in forwards for half of next year's receivables before the winter shipping season. I lean yes; Ilona will bring the final proposal. The sensitive context sits in the confidential note just below.

internal memo for faweg-tafog: Only 7 of the 100 pilot accounts renewed Quenael, so a churn review is set for April 15.

**Vendor note: Inkmill markdown pipeline**

Rendering for Parchway docs is outsourced to Inkmill under an annual contract, renewing each March. They handle sanitization and PDF export; we own the upload queue. SLA: 4-hour response on rendering failures. Escalate only after two failed retries. Their support desk is reachable at the address below.

billing contact of hahaf-baguf = zorael.tammir.jorius@sivrelhq.internal